Tapping is disabled on Wacom tablets that really need it
The "tap-to-click" setting applies to all touchpad devices in mutter, with a default to off. This is a problem for Wacom devices that look like touchpads but don't have any physical buttons at all (e.g. the Intuos Pro series). On those, the tablet is mostly unusable because you can't click until tapping is enabled - that then also enables it on the touchpad which may not be intended.
I'm not sure what the solution should be here. libinput enables tapping by default on those devices but for obvious reasons users may want to disable it, that's why the option is available. You could check whether BTN_LEFT exists on the device and make some decision based on that but that doesn't solve things either. Really what we need here is some sort of "stick to the default unless otherwise specified".
